Custom wedding signage, designed and made locally
Wedding signage covers every printed or cut piece that guides and greets guests on the day: the welcome sign at the entrance, the seating chart, table numbers, bar and dessert signs and directional signs around the venue. Good signage reads as one suite with your invitations, which is why every Ghost Booth Events sign starts from your stationery, not from a template.

Materials
- ✓Clear or frosted acrylicModern, lightweight, most popular for welcome signs
- ✓Mirror acrylic (gold, silver, rose)Reflective finish that photographs beautifully in low light
- ✓Linen & satinSoft fabric finish for romantic or garden weddings
- ✓Timber & painted boardRustic and hills venues
- ✓Foil and mirror vinyl letteringApplied to any base for a two-tone look

Wedding signage FAQs
How much does wedding signage cost in Melbourne?
Ghost Booth Events wedding signage packages start from $500. A package typically covers a welcome sign plus a seating chart or table numbers in matching materials; individual pieces are quoted by size, material (acrylic, mirror, linen, timber) and whether a stand or easel is included. Signage bundled with a photo booth booking is discounted and delivered free.
How far ahead should I order wedding signage?
Allow four to six weeks: one to two weeks for design and proofing, then two to three weeks for production. Seating charts are finalised last, usually 10 days before the wedding once RSVPs close. Rush orders are possible depending on material.
What size should a wedding welcome sign be?
A1 (594 × 841 mm) is the most common size for a welcome sign on an easel, and it reads clearly from about five metres. Venues with a long entrance or outdoor ceremony often go larger, up to 900 × 1200 mm, or use a free-standing arch panel.
